The advanced technologies being used in diagnosis and care within modern medicine, whilst supporting and making medical practices possible, may also conflict with established traditions of medicine and care. The changes in medical practices bought about by the involvement of these artefacts highlights some interesting questions to be addressed in this volume through a focus on various technological practices within hospitals and sociotechnical systems of care.
